Drug and Alcohol Detox Withdrawal Symptoms

Research on alcohol and drug withdrawal shows that when you abruptly stop using different drugs and/or alcohol, you may experience various symptoms; these symptoms - and their severity - will vary from one client to the other.

Some things that could influence your experience during withdrawal as you undergo detox include:

The length of time you have been addicted; if it was for an extended time, withdrawal may be more severe.

The combination of substances you abused; in most cases, you may find that those who are addicted to more than one substance might experience unique withdrawal with a myriad of unusual symptoms because one substance could intensify the other's symptoms.

The dosage of the drugs you were abusing when you entered the detoxification program in Posen, Illinois. If a person has been abusing drugs or alcohol for an extended amount of time, they may have developed a tolerance; basically, they may have to up the amount of drugs and/or alcohol the use to get the effect that they want. However, these higher amounts used might eventually mean that your withdrawal could be more severe when you decide to quit.

The existence of any co-occurring mental and physical health disorders; people with mental health conditions like anxiety or physical issues such as insomnia and chronic pain might have more intense distress and withdrawal symptoms.

The half life of the drugs; short-acting drugs cause more immediate withdrawal symptoms while long-acting substances may cause your withdrawal symptoms to be delayed for hours or days.

Recent studies on addiction rehab show that when you go through detoxification, you might develop any of the following withdrawal symptoms:

  • Agitation
  • Chills
  • Cravings
  • Flu-like symptoms, which could include vomiting, nausea, headache, and runny nose
  • Irritability
  • Mood swings
  • Shaking
  • Sleep disturbances and insomnia
  • Sweating
  • Tremors
